Neurological therapy devices
First Claim
1. A neurological therapy device for the local and controlled delivery of a neurotransmitter to the brain of a subject, said device comprising:
- a source of neurotransmitter including at least one neurotransmitter-secreting cell encapsulated within a semipermeable membrane, said semipermeable membrane allowing the diffusion therethrough of said neurotransmitter; and
a source of a growth factor located in close proximity to said encapsulated, neurotransmitter-producing cell for the maintenance of said neurotransmitter-producing cell,said source of said growth factor selected from the group consisting of an implantable, biocompatible, polymeric insert containing said growth factor, and at least one growth factor-producing cell encapsulated within a semipermeable membrane that allows the diffusion therethrough of said growth factor,said source of neurotransmitter and said source of growth factor including access means for retrieval from the brain.

Abstract
Neurological therapy devices are disclosed for the local and controlled delivery of a neurotransmitter to the brain of a subject suffering from neurotransmitter deficiency or dysfunction. In one embodiment the device includes a biocompatible, implantable, and retrievable polymeric insert including a source of neurotransmitter embedded therein. In another embodiment, the device includes a retrievable source of neurotransmitter including at least one neurotransmitter-secreting cell encapsulated within a semipermeable membrane allowing the diffusion therethrough of the neurotransmitter, and further includes a source of growth factor in close proximity to the neurotransmitter-secreting cells.
